How much do Security Specialist services cost?

How much do Security Specialists charge? Prices for Security Specialists in 2025 can fluctuate depending upon the type of work that you require to have carried out in your residence. It's the concern we get asked a great deal "how much do Security Specialists charge?". It's often better to have an idea of how much a Security Specialist are going to likely charge for their services. Rates are going to rise and fall based on the materials as well as the tradesman selected. The table reveals the sorts of job that Security Specialists commonly do and the standard price variety of these projects. Some jobs take longer to finish than others so prices do vary by task.

The average price
of a Security Specialist in St Helens is:

£1,192

Security Specialist job Security Specialist cost in 2025
Cctv in St Helens £563-£863
Home intercoms in St Helens £338-£518
Intruder Alarm in St Helens £231-£351
Security gates in St Helens £3,380-£6,750
Security shutters in St Helens £375-£575
Smoke alarms in St Helens £113-£173

how to install a security gate?

Having a security gate installed on your property brings about a lot of benefits. However, to ensure these benefits are maximized, it’s important to make sure the gates are properly installed. The installation can be made a DIY task or professionally installed. If you wish to install your security gates by yourself, then you’ve come to the right place! In this post, we’re going to take you through the processes involved in the installation of a security gate. Let’s take a look!

  1. Go through the instructions carefully to get the best out of your installation and also a good understanding.
  2. Dig holes for the posts. Don’t make holes round to make sure the posts do not turn or twist.
  3. Get rid of any obstructions like uneven ground, rocks or any other obstacles that may impact the free opening of the gate.
  4. Re-confirm the distance between the two poles to make sure that the gate can hang perfectly between them.
  5. Get an adjustable hinge. Adjustable hinge will allow for extra customization while also enabling improved correction of errors.
  6. Make sure that the measurement taken leaves sufficient space for vehicles such as emergency vehicles and package delivery trucks when opened.
  7. If you have a fence that’ll be connected to the gate, you should install the gate at the back of the fencing pillars. If you later decide to automate the security gate, this will prove to be a smart move as it enables a free and unhindered function.
  8. Make sure you go through the local laws before installation.
What are network enabled or IP cameras?

Network enabled/IP cameras are digital CCTV cameras. With these cameras, the video captured can be streamed over the internet anywhere in the world. Most manufacturers of IP cameras have a smartphone app that allows you to watch the video feed on your phone.

Will my alarm system cause lots of false alarms?

Properly installed and calibrated alarm systems will very rarely trigger a false alarm. If you have pets you will need to use pet-friendly alarm systems. External sensors should be properly calibrated to avoid triggering in the wind or rain. NSI is a recognised standard for all alarm installations, check the NSI flag is displayed on an installers credentials.

Are wireless alarm systems reliable?

Modern wireless alarm systems are as reliable as wired systems. Wireless systems can transmit alerts as quickly and reliably as wired systems. They are also suitable for installation in more places as there does not need to be space to hide the wires.

What is an intruder alarm system?

The simplest definition of an intruder alarm system can be gotten from its name. Basically, it can be referred to as a method or means through which a property is protected against intruders via a system of interconnected devices and components which alerts or notifies the owner or monitoring station whenever there is a violation.

The intruder alarm system is an integrated electronic devices network which works together and features a central control panel which keeps the facility secured against all potential home intruders.

An intruder alarm system, typically, features the following:

• Control Panel - Primary controller of the entire system.

• Interior and exterior motion sensors

• Security cameras, either wired or wireless

• Sensors, for both doors and windows

• An alarm or siren

• Window stickers & yard sign.

Depending on the security needs as well as budget, the intruder alarm system can be a simple one suitable for the basic protection of a home, or a more advanced one which does not only protects the facility but also goes a long way to make the users’ life a lot more comfortable. The later can perform a plethora of great functions in home automation such as access controls, and heating and lighting control. With the features of the property in mind, alongside the investor’s security needs and future expansion possibilities, an intruder system installation company can help select the best option for the home or property.

What’s more? The intruder alarm system’s manipulators or interface devices are modern touch panels that have been designed not only to showcase its visual appeal and intuitive operation, but also to ensure the smooth and easy control of the whole system by storing maps of the property on memory cards. And to the delight of both investors and potential investors, the system can also be controlled directly from mobile devices or PCs which features the necessary applications and internet connection. What's the best burglar alarm?

According to several studies and survey of ex-burglars, a home or building is less likely to be burgled with the availability of properly functioning and well fitted burglar alarm system. So if you’re thinking about installing one in your house, you can as well make sure you get the best possible burglar alarm that’s just right for your home. Several people asks the question of the best burglar alarm, but the fact is, it all depends on a number of factors such as your budget, personal preferences, your location, home features as well as the protection and response level you require. To put you in the right direction to make the best choice, here’s a breakdown of the types of burglar alarm systems to help you determine the one that will best suit your home.

lBells-Only Alarms

This makes a loud sound but that’s as far as it goes. It will not contact anyone.

Pros

• No monitoring contract and payment

• Easy to install

Cons

• It does not contact anyone.

• It may not deter the burglars if there’s no one around to stop the intrusion.

lDialler Burglar Alarms

This contacts your phone or any other numbers nominated once the alarm is triggered.

Pros

• No monitoring contract and payment.

• Nominated numbers would be dialled

• It can also notify you of other dangers such as fire if extra sensors are acquired.

Cons

• If you opt for a GSM dialler, a weak mobile network can affect its effectiveness

• Nominated numbers may be unavailable when dialled.

lSmart home security system

This contacts your or your loved ones whenever the alarm is triggered via a Smartphone or tablet application.

Pros

• Notifies you when away from home

• Can be monitored and controlled from a Smartphone

Cons

• If you opt for a GSM dialler, a weak mobile network can affect its effectiveness

• They can be expensive depending on your selected elements

lA monitoring contract

This implies paying a monthly or annual fee to a company to act or notify the police the your alarm is triggered

Pros

• The monitoring company is in hand to act in order to prevent the potential burglary and liable if it doesn’t.

• Some of the companies also offer maintenance services

Cons

• Expensive

• It cannot be installed by yourself

How does an intruder alarm system work?

Intruder alarm systems work in various ways and all with one goal in mind - ensuring the safety of both the building and valuables. Whether it’s a small or big home or property, there is a wide range of systems that can be installed to guarantee adequate protection from unwanted visitors. They work with various applications and you get to determine the action to be made in the event whereby the protected zone is violated and system triggered.

Intruder Alarm Systems come in three main types which includes:

• The Bells-Only Intruder Alarm System - Whenever there is a violation, the only action would be to trigger the alarm, nothing more.

• The Communicators - These alarm systems are basically speech dialers which automatically sends a message to various selected number whenever there is an intrusion.

• Monitored Systems - Here, the monitoring centre would be alerted once there is a breach in security.

However, irrespective of the type, most intruder alarm systems operate following a similar series of steps.

lSensing of motion. The systems usually feature door and window sensors which detects any contact of the door/window in the frame when shut. There are also the motion sensors which can be strategically stationed across the property to detect any motion and possible breach of security.

lTriggering of the control panel. The system is interconnected, and all components are linked to a control panel where all detectors’ and sensors’ generated informations are relayed. The alarm countdown is activated in the event whereby a contact is made and circuit impacted.

lSounding of the alarm - Once the alarm countdown has been initiated, failure to insert an abort code will ultimately sound the alarm. The external sounder that comes with the system produces a loud sound to notify people about the security breach or intrusion. There is also an interior sounder which works to bring the presence of an intruder to the awareness of the occupants.

Does CCTV deter crime?

Various studies have suggested that CCTV is an effective deterrent against home burglaries. In the event that a crime is committed on your property, well placed CCTV means you’ll have the evidence to help the police. It has been recorded consistantly that since CCTV systems have been installed, localised crime has fallen and has lead to more arrests.
